In 2025, the membership feen for the Entrepreneur Fund will be 1.7% of the part of the insured annual income exceeding EUR 9 600.

You can choose up to the level of pension insurance (YEL, MYEL, TyEL) corresponding to your annual income. The sum can therefore be any amount you choose that exceeds €15 128. You can use the member fee calculator to calculate the amount of your membership fee.

The Financial Supervisory Authority confirms the membership fee of the Entrepreneur Fund on the basis of the Fund’s proposal. The unemployment fund membership fee must be set at a level that, together with the contributions, is sufficient to meet the unemployment fund’s commitments, i.e. to pay benefits. In addition, when the membership fee is fixed, account must be taken of the fact that the unemployment fund must have a smoothing fund to which the annual surplus of the unemployment fund is transferred in order to ensure its financing and liquidity.

The Entrepreneur Fund will be paid an amount equal to the basic daily allowance (EUR 37.21 in 2025) for each earnings-related daily allowance, and the rest of the funding will be covered by the Entrepreneur Fund itself. The Employees’ Fund will be paid a state contribution and a contribution from the Employment Fund. The Employees’ Fund will be responsible for 5.5% of the earnings-related daily allowance, while the Entrepreneur Fund will be responsible for around 40%. Due to the different funding base, the Entrepreneur Fund has a higher membership fee than the Employees’ Fund.
